    Road Closures

    From 21 January 2019:

    Junction The Causeway and Boxted Road to Junction Boxted Road and Holly Lane Great Horkesley CO6 4AP

    Access required to BT under ground structure for cabling and jointing works and overhead cabling and jointing works. No excavation work involved.
    Wet Lane Boxted

    Wet Lane, Boxted from a point approximately 85m north of its junction with Green Lane for a distance of approximately 30m in a northerly direction.

    The closure is scheduled to commence on 21st January 2019 for 3 days, or where stated on a valid permit (AD03010536924 – Anglian Water). The scheduled dates may vary for these works with appropriate signs showing and/or displayed on www.roadworks.org.

    The closure is required for the safety of the public and workforce while disconnection works are undertaken by Anglian Water.

    An alternative route is available via Green Lane, Road From Boxted Church Road To Green Lane, Boxted Church Road, Church Road and vice versa.

    Access for emergency service vehicles and pedestrians will be maintained at all times during the closure.

    The village whodunnit is back for those who missed it in September.

    Saturday 23 March

    Join the Boxted Amateur Players at the Village Hall for an evening of entertainment where the audience try to solve the mystery of who bumped off Roger Botham. After a series of comedy sketches all leading to a sticky end for Roger, the local bigot, the audience have to try and establish just who was the murderer.

    Tickets are £12 and include dinner and entertainment. There will be a licensed bar and tickets are available to book from boxtedap

    All proceeds will be going to the Boxted St Peter’s

    Church Tower Repair Fund.
